Hey guys just incase people really want to use this as a guide, here are some tips. **Always apply primer surfacer before and after spray putty. Wait 10 minutes between all coats. **Also a plastic primer is needed for bare plastic and etch primer for bare metal. **The primer needs to dry overnight before sanding and for metallic colours finish with 800g **Leaving the base overnight is not really the best thing to do. Spraying the clear within 30min of applying the base is the best, the pores of the base coat are still open and ready for the clear. The clear can possibly peel and have poor adhesion otherwise. Wouldn't want all that work to go to waste. **The clear from a can needs to dry overnight then sanded with 1200g and buffed with compound to get the correct gloss. Surprised they didn’t mention around 4:35 the reason it’s better to remove the panels, if you’re doing a full job, is to get better coverage on the edges of the panels, and run less risk of it peeling from those edges in the future Also both Marty and Moog have some major mistakes with their spray technique, Marty was too close and fanning it, and Moog was just whipping his arm back and forth lol. Supposed to keep the nozzle exactly parallel to the surface you’re painting, and move about a foot per second, little bit faster or slower depending the thickness of coat you’re on. The odds of ending up with a mismatch between the fender-door/hood is pretty high if your not blending out your color. Following this process using 2-part aerosol cans (contain a hardener) would greatly improve the quality and durability.
